Saint Etienne, the renowned British indie electronic-pop band, is set to embark on a farewell tour across Australia and New Zealand later this year. The tour will commence on November 20, 2025, at Auckland’s Powerstation, followed by a performance in Wellington on November 21. The band will then perform in five Australian capital cities: Adelaide on November 23, Melbourne on November 26, Sydney on November 27, Brisbane on November 29, and finally in Perth on December 1. This tour coincides with the release of their last studio album, 'International', which features a collaboration with Brisbane's Confidence Man. The album peaked at No. 8 on the Official U.K. Albums Chart. Over their 35-year career, Saint Etienne has been celebrated for their unique blend of pop and electronic music, achieving significant chart success with 17 singles in the U.K. top 40. The bandmates, Bob Stanley and Pete Wiggs, have been friends since childhood, and they intend to conclude their musical journey together while still remaining close friends.
